<?xml version="1.0" encoding="UTF-8" standalone="yes" ?>
<!DOCTYPE bugzilla SYSTEM "https://bugs.webkit.org/page.cgi?id=bugzilla.dtd">

<bugzilla version="5.0.4.1"
          urlbase="https://bugs.webkit.org/"
          
          maintainer="admin@webkit.org"
>

    <bug>
          <bug_id>153756</bug_id>
          
          <creation_ts>2016-02-01 13:09:25 -0800</creation_ts>
          <short_desc>Web Inspector: DataGridNode should support adding/removing a status element to any cell</short_desc>
          <delta_ts>2026-01-12 09:04:25 -0800</delta_ts>
          <reporter_accessible>1</reporter_accessible>
          <cclist_accessible>1</cclist_accessible>
          <classification_id>1</classification_id>
          <classification>Unclassified</classification>
          <product>WebKit</product>
          <component>Web Inspector</component>
          <version>WebKit Nightly Build</version>
          <rep_platform>All</rep_platform>
          <op_sys>All</op_sys>
          <bug_status>NEW</bug_status>
          <resolution></resolution>
          
          
          <bug_file_loc></bug_file_loc>
          <status_whiteboard></status_whiteboard>
          <keywords>InRadar</keywords>
          <priority>P2</priority>
          <bug_severity>Normal</bug_severity>
          <target_milestone>---</target_milestone>
          
          <blocked>153032</blocked>
          <everconfirmed>1</everconfirmed>
          <reporter name="Matt Baker">mattbaker</reporter>
          <assigned_to name="Matt Baker">mattbaker</assigned_to>
          <cc>graouts</cc>
    
    <cc>inspector-bugzilla-changes</cc>
    
    <cc>webkit-bug-importer</cc>
          

      

      

      

          <comment_sort_order>oldest_to_newest</comment_sort_order>  
          <long_desc isprivate="0" >
    <commentid>1160985</commentid>
    <comment_count>0</comment_count>
    <who name="Matt Baker">mattbaker</who>
    <bug_when>2016-02-01 13:09:25 -0800</bug_when>
    <thetext>* SUMMARY
DataGridNode should support adding/removing a status element to any cell.

As part of the Timelines UI redesign, grids will need cells with status elements, so the Network and Overview grids can display an IndeterminateProgressSpinner for loading resources.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>1160986</commentid>
    <comment_count>1</comment_count>
    <who name="Radar WebKit Bug Importer">webkit-bug-importer</who>
    <bug_when>2016-02-01 13:09:52 -0800</bug_when>
    <thetext>&lt;rdar://problem/24444108&gt;</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>1160988</commentid>
    <comment_count>2</comment_count>
    <who name="Joseph Pecoraro">joepeck</who>
    <bug_when>2016-02-01 13:11:50 -0800</bug_when>
    <thetext>Again, this sounds to me like something that should go inside a cell itself, instead of DataGridNode. We already have TimelineDataGridNode, perhaps these should be going in there?</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>1160999</commentid>
    <comment_count>3</comment_count>
    <who name="Matt Baker">mattbaker</who>
    <bug_when>2016-02-01 13:25:43 -0800</bug_when>
    <thetext>(In reply to comment #2)
&gt; Again, this sounds to me like something that should go inside a cell itself,
&gt; instead of DataGridNode. We already have TimelineDataGridNode, perhaps these
&gt; should be going in there?

Not sure what you mean by placing it &quot;in the cell itself&quot;, since we deal in grid nodes/rows, not cells.

I like placing it in DataGridNode, since it feels like basic functionality which could have utility outside the timeline grids (even though TimelineDataGridNode is the only use case as of now).</thetext>
  </long_desc>
      
      

    </bug>

</bugzilla>